Our client, a well-established construction services company specializing in demolition and environmental services across the Greater Toronto Area, is looking for a Finance Assistant (AR/AP). This role is a great opportunity to be hands-on with key financial operations in a fast-paced, project-driven environment, working closely with project managers, vendors, unions, and senior leadership. The organization values collaboration, trust, and autonomy, empowering employees to take ownership and succeed.
Responsibilities
Accounts Receivable (AR)/ Accounts Payable (AP)
- Prepare and issue customer invoices based on project progress
- Work with project managers to confirm invoicing schedules
- Track and organize project-related receipts and documentation
- Oversee accounts receivable activities, and provide backup support for AR function
- Follow up on outstanding customer balances as required
- Prepare and issue payments to suppliers
- Reconcile supplier statements with bank records
- Resolve invoice discrepancies and billing issues
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date supplier records
- Assist with AP aging reports and month-end/year-end close
- Reconcile supplier statements with bank records
Admin Duties
- Prepare and distribute company information packages to potential clients
- Administer contract documentation and send contracts to clients
- Manage change orders by updating contracts for any project related changes
- Maintain organized digital and physical records for audit and compliance purposes
- Reconcile vendor and financial records in preparation for tax filings
- Work closely with the company’s external accountant on tax and financial reconciliations
- Ensure financial documentation is accurate and audit-ready
Union Reporting
- Extract unionized employee data
- Calculate union dues, benefit contributions and submit union remittance reports
- Issue payments to unions in accordance with agreements
- Record union-related transactions in the general ledger
- Ensure compliance with union reporting and payment timelines
